Will Young Announces New Single Thank You
Will Young



Will Young announces the release of his brand new single ‘Thank You’ to be released through Island Records on July 24th 2015. ‘Thank You’ is the second single to be taken from Will’s critically acclaimed new album ‘85% Proof’ which went straight in at Number One on the UK Official Album Chart this month, his fourth Number One album.

‘Thank You’, written by Will with Jim Eliot, is one of Will’s greatest musical accomplishments so far and comes complete with one of the best final lines in a song you are likely to hear this year! Stay tuned to the album version to hear it in full effect…

‘Thank You’ also comes with a stunningly choreographed and captivating video shot in the historic Porchester Baths in London. Watch the video from Tuesday 16th June at http://www.vevo.com/artist/will-young

Will has also confirmed a UK nationwide tour to take place during October and November 2015.

‘The Love Revolution Tour’, Will’s first tour in four years, starts in York on 29th October and runs across the UK & Ireland finishing in London at the Hammersmith Apollo on 29thNovember. Tickets are available from: http://www.livenation.co.uk/artist/will-young-tickets

‘85% Proof’ is the sixth album from the multi-million selling Brit Award winning singer-songwriter and represents his most accomplished work to date. The record is an eclectic, hugely confident and startlingly human record which Clash described as ‘The most deliciously instinctive and relentlessly endearing pop music you’ll hear this year. A masterclass in delivering a mature pop record’. Meanwhile The Sun called the album ‘pure class’ and The Guardian said it was ‘A reminder of how good Young can be.’

‘85% Proof’ follows up Will’s No 1 album ‘Echoes’ released in 2011 which has sold over half a million copies. In the intervening years Will moved back to theatre staring as The Emcee in Cabaret (for which he was nominated for an Olivier Award); presented an ITV documentary on surrealist artist Magritte; filtered his passion for politics via blogs for the likes of Huffington Post; wrote a best-selling biography and fronted a campaign for Stonewall. He also started teaching and mentoring other singer-songwriters.

Produced by previous collaborator Jim Eliot (Mikky Ekko, Ellie Goulding), ‘85% Proof’ is a creative reflection of Will’s extracurricular activities post-Echoes and his most personal/honest songwriting to date. Writing and recording for the new record also coincided with a move to a brand new label, Island Records.

SINGLE REVIEW: WILL YOUNG – ‘THANK YOU’
Published On July 4, 2015 | By Meggie Morris | Music, Singles & EP's
Despite widespread cynicism surrounding talent show acts, the first ever winner of the worldwide “Pop Idol” franchise, Will Young, has surpassed the sceptical expectations of his critics and firmly established himself as a pop music mastermind with an exceptional voice. Since winning the British music contest in 2002, Young has forged for himself a varied career. As well as starring in musical productions, presenting documentaries, writing political pieces for outlets including the Huffington Post, and penning a best-selling biography, Young has casually released six albums to date, including four number ones. His most recent offering, 85% Proof, has been described by Clash Magazine as ‘The most deliciously instinctive and relentlessly endearing pop music you’ll hear this year”. Thank You, the latest single to be lifted from the album, speaks volumes about the singer’s astonishing ability to continually create big pop ballads, which take inspiration from numerous genres, but unfailingly centre on that distinctive voice and graceful melodic writing.
Will Young 85 ProofWith Thank You, the talent that won him an entry into the industry over a decade ago is immediately obvious. A mist of redolent strings and a chorus of female backing singers support his incredibly expressive voice, which is captivating as it is communicative. The choir eventually drops to a single female voice delivering vocal counterpoint to Young’s chorus at the track’s affecting climax. Soulful undertones of melancholy pave the way for a dramatically subdued ending, as Young delivers an exasperated final dismissal to whoever had the audacity to break his heart, and ours in the process.
As Young is set to embark upon his first tour in four years (The Love Revolution National UK Tour) Thank You reminds us that the marriage of intelligent, mature writing with an exceptional voice and evocative presence is a sincere winner and Young’s forte – a deceptively simple formula that will see the artist thrive for another 13 years of miscellaneous successes.
